GRE (Glass Reinforced Epoxy/ Fiberglass Reinforced Plastic) piping is a mature and increasingly popular choice in ship ballast water systems, especially in newbuilding and retrofit projects.


Key Advantages of GRE Piping

1. Excellent Corrosion Resistance:

Core Advantage: Ballast water contains seawater, sediment, and microorganisms, making it highly corrosive. GRE piping is inherently non-corrosive, 

eliminating the need for internal coatings or cathodic protection and completely avoiding the issues of rust and perforation common in steel pipes.

Low Maintenance Cost: Over its entire lifecycle, it requires almost no repair or replacement due to corrosion, drastically reducing maintenance efforts (such as descaling and painting) and costs.


2. Light Weight:

The density of GRE is only about one-quarter that of steel. In extensive ballast water systems that run throughout the ship, 

weight reduction positively impacts the vessel's stability and deadweight, contributing to improved energy efficiency and cargo capacity.


3. Superior Fluid Flow Characteristics:

Smooth Internal Surface: Low hydraulic friction coefficient reduces head loss, which can improve pumping efficiency or

allow for the use of smaller diameter pipes, further reducing weight and cost.

Resistance to Biofouling: The smooth surface hinders the adhesion of marine organisms and sediment, helping to maintain flow capacity and better aligning 

with the performance requirements of modern Ballast Water Treatment Systems (BWTS).


4. Ease of Installation:

Utilizes bell-and-spigot adhesive joints or flanged connections, eliminating the need for welding and the associated risks and costs of hot work. 

Installation is faster and requires relatively lower skill levels from workers.

Piping sections can be prefabricated as needed and assembled on-site.


5. Long Service Life:

The designed service life typically exceeds 25 years, matching the vessel's lifecycle well.
